Business Administration Wages Near Sonoma

Sonoma is part of the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A metro area (BLS area code 42220).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to California stat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
General and Operations Manager$114,510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$106,224
Administrative Services Manager$97,550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$90,492
Financial Manager$156,840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$145,492
Human Resources Manager$154,960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$143,748
Management Analyst$93,760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$86,976
Project Management Specialist$105,830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$98,173
Accountant or Auditor$88,320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$81,929
Training and Development Specialist$64,390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$59,731
Office and Administrative Support Supervisor$72,980Santa Rosa-Petaluma, CA$67,699

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.


Sonoma at a Glance

MetricValueSource
Population10,726Census ACS 2023 5-yr (B01003)
Median household income$101,281Census ACS 2023 5-yr (B19013)
Adults 25+ with bachelor’s+47.7%Census ACS 2023 5-yr (B15003)
Regional Price Parity (US=100)107.8 (above U.S. average)BEA RPP 2024
Business Administration-related employment in Sonoma County4,947 workers, 808 establishmentsBLS QCEW 2024 annual

How do I verify a program is accredited?

Confirm institutional accreditation via the U.S. Department of Education database (U.S. Dept. of Education database), and check for any program-specific accreditation listed by the school.
